  Jalen McCleskey's legs are churning so fast on the video that you almost think the footage is doctored. He's running 23 mph, the maximum speed this particular treadmill can go. For McCleskey, a Covington native who just completed his career at Tulane after transferring from Oklahoma State, speed is his ticket to the NFL. But because of the coronavirus pandemic, McCleskey won't get to showcase that speed at a pro day in front of NFL scouts. Tulane's pro day, like every other school's pro day, was canceled. So instead, the 5-foot-10, 175-pound receiver will have to do the next best thing: get someone to record him doing the 40-yard dash and measure him all the other typical pro day tests. For McCleskey, that will happen Friday on the campus of Nicholls State, where he will be joined by defensive lineman and Tulane teammate Mike Hinton, as well as Nicholls quarterback Chase Fourcade.

"It's going to be different because usually the scouts get to come and see it in person," McCleskey said. "Pro day was going to be big for me, so people could see my numbers. Hopefully with the video it will be the same." McCleskey, the son of former New Orleans Saints defensive back J.J. McCleskey, has been preparing for this moment while he also finishes up work on his master's degree. He's had to alter some of his normal workout routines since pretty much everything is shut down. "It's been really crazy," McCleskey said. "I've still been working out, but we just had to find different places." - New Orleans Times Picayune
